この記事は機械翻訳のミラー記事です。元の記事にジャンプするにはこちらをクリックしてください。

眺める: 3436|答える: 2

[出典] Windows 下でのMySQL 8.0.36インストールチュートリアル

[リンクをコピー]
掲載地 2024/04/11 19:52:21 | | | |
言うまでもなく、MySQLデータベースプログラマーはWindows 8.0.36サービスのインストール方法を知っています。

ダウンロード:ハイパーリンクのログインが見えます。「mysql-8.0.36-winx64.zip」を選択してダウンロードしてください。以下の図に示されています:



必要に応じて指定されたディレクトリへ抽出します。例えば:C:\Database\mysql-8.0.36-winx64ディレクトリの下に新しいmy.iniファイルを作成し、以下のように設定する方法:

binフォルダにアクセスし、以下のコマンドで初期化します:



生成されたパスワードを覚えて、以下のコマンドでMySQLサービスのインストールを開始してください:

次のコマンドで礼拝を開始します:

MySQLのbinパスを環境変数に追加し、mysqld経由でコンソールにアクセスします。 (省略)



入力後はパスワードを変更する必要があります。そうでなければエラーは以下のようになります:

エラー1820(HY000):この文を実行する前にALTER USER文を使ってパスワードをリセットしてください。
パスワードを変更するコマンドは以下の通りです:

(終わり)





先の:Windows Mavenの設定チュートリアルをダウンロードしてインストールしてください
次に:ウェブサイトモジュールの要件
 地主| 掲載地 2024/04/11 19:54:59 |
キャッシュSHA2パスワードとMySQLネイティブパスワードは、MySQLデータベース管理システムで認証に使用される2つの異なるプラグインです。 これら2つのプラグインの主な違いは、使用されているハッシュアルゴリズムとセキュリティです

分かつ

MySQLネイティブパスワード:これは初期バージョンのMySQLのデフォルトの認証プラグインで、SHA1ハッシュ関数を使ってパスワードをハッシュ化しデータベースに保存します。 ユーザーがログインしようとすると、システムは入力したパスワードを同じようにハッシュ化し、保存されたハッシュと比較します。 2つが一致すると、ユーザーはログインを許可されます。 しかし、近年、SHA1のセキュリティは何度も疑問視されてきたため、MySQLはその後のリリースで新しい認証プラグインを導入しました

キャッシュSHA2パスワード:これはMySQL 8.0以降のデフォルトの認証プラグインです。 より安全なSHA-256ハッシュ関数を使用しています。 セキュリティ強化に加え、このプラグインはパスワードキャッシュという新機能も導入しています。 つまり、ユーザーがログインに成功すると、そのパスワード(正確にはパスワードのハッシュ)がキャッシュされます。 したがって、ユーザーが再度ログインしようとした場合、システムはキャッシュから直接パスワード認証を行い、完全なハッシュ処理を繰り返す必要がありません。 これによりシステムの性能が大幅に向上します
 地主| 掲載地 2024/04/12 14:24:41 |
CentOS 7はrpmを使ってMySQLデータベースをインストールします
https://www.itsvse.com/thread-10242-1-1.html
免責事項:
Code Farmer Networkが発行するすべてのソフトウェア、プログラミング資料、記事は学習および研究目的のみを目的としています。 上記の内容は商業的または違法な目的で使用されてはならず、そうでなければ利用者はすべての結果を負うことになります。 このサイトの情報はインターネットからのものであり、著作権紛争はこのサイトとは関係ありません。 ダウンロード後24時間以内に上記の内容を完全にパソコンから削除してください。 もしこのプログラムを気に入ったら、正規のソフトウェアを支持し、登録を購入し、より良い本物のサービスを受けてください。 もし侵害があれば、メールでご連絡ください。

Mail To:help@itsvse.com